
HDB lift door opening is the real limit at around 90cm wide. Standard HDB door measures about 91.5x213cm for internal passage. Leave a 2–5cm buffer to ensure smooth movement through corridors. The lift door, corridor turn, or internal doorway is usually the limiting point.
Queen bed dimensions measure 152x190cm and suit most HDB master bedrooms comfortably. Leave around 60cm clearance on the exit side for comfortable walking and movement. Standard length 190cm fits standard room lengths without awkward gaps. The bedroom set ensures no overcrowding of living space.
SG humidity typically around 80%+ affects untreated leather and solid timber hardest. Untreated leather can grow mould without wiping and ventilation regularly. Humidity and sun damage materials faster than in other climates significantly. Buyers should choose performance fabrics or treated wood for longevity.
Storage beds suit HDB flats where nowhere else for luggage exists. Hydraulic lift-up needs overhead clearance, drawers need floor clearance for smooth opening. Solid-wood and plywood frames outlast particleboard significantly in the long term always. Rubberwood is a common affordable hardwood suitable for bedroom sets usually. Foam density drives how long cushions hold shape over years reliably. Full-grain leather lasts best while bonded PU peel over time very significantly.
